Obituary
Gerald Wayne Epps, 85, of Chesterfield, VA went to be with the Lord on Friday, January 24, 2025. He was preceded in death by his parents, Wingate and Viola Epps; sisters, Emma Combs, Mary Martin and Patty Epps; and brothers, Marshall Epps and James Epps. Gerald is survived by his beloved wife, Barbara Gill Epps; son, Wayne Epps (Lorrie); granddaughters, Lindsey Passmore (Matt), Ashley Epps (Sterling), Taylor Epps (Jarrett), and Cortney Brown (Frankie); great-grandchildren, Carter and Camden Passmore, and Jade and Michael Bennett; and numerous nieces and nephews. Gerald was a proud member of the Sappony Indian Tribe. A visitation will be held from 2:00 PM – 4:00 PM & 6:00 PM – 8:00 PM on Thursday, January 30 at Morrissett Funeral & Cremation Service, 6500 Iron Bridge Rd., N. Chesterfield, VA 23234. In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the Alzheimer’s Association, https://www.alz.org/.
